Remove Oil
1. With the engine off but still warm, disconnect the spark
plug wire(s) (D, Figure 22) and keep it away from the
spark plug(s) (E).

2. Remove the dipstick (A, Figure 23).

3. Remove the oil drain plug (F, Figure 24). Drain the oil into
an approved container.

4. After the oil has drained, install and tighten the oil drain
plug (F, Figure 24). 
Change Oil Filter, if equipped
Some models are equipped with an oil filter. For replacement
intervals, see the Maintenance Schedule.  
1. Drain the oil from the engine. See Remove Oil  section. 
2. Remove the oil filter (G, Figure 24) and discard. 
3. Lightly lubricate the oil filter gasket with clean oil. 
4. Install the oil filter by hand until the gasket touches the oil
filter adapter, then tighten the oil filter 1/2 to 3/4 turns. 
5. Add oil. See Add Oil section. 
6. Start the engine. As the engine warms up, check for oil
leaks. 
7. Stop the engine and check the oil level. The correct oil
level is at the top of the full indicator (B, Figure 23) on the
dipstick. 
Add Oil
• Make sure that the engine is level. 
• Clean the oil fill area of any debris. 
• See the Specifications section for oil capacity. 
1. Pull out the dipstick (A, Figure 23).  Remove oil from the
dipstick with a clean cloth. 
2. Slowly add oil into the engine oil fill (C, Figure 23). Do not
overfill.  Wait one minute and then check the oil level. 
3. Install and tighten the dipstick (A, Figure 23). 
4. Remove the dipstick and check the oil level. The correct
oil level is at the top of the full indicator (B, Figure 23) on
the dipstick. 
5. Install and tighten the dipstick (A, Figure 23).
6. Connect the spark plug wire(s) (D, Figure 22) to the spark
plug(s) (E). 

Paper Air Filter

1. Remove the fastener(s) (A, Figure 25).
